Bachelor of Property (BProp)

The Bachelor of Property prepares you with the academic background to enter any branch of the property profession in New Zealand or internationally.

The degree fulfils the academic requirements for membership of professional bodies such as:

  • The Valuers Registration Board
  • The Property Institute of New Zealand
  • The Real Estate Institute of New Zealand
  • The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ors.

Pathways into the BProp

Transfer and entry with a completed MIT diploma

If you have a completed MIT diploma (Level 6 or 7) you may:

  • Apply and gain entry with up to 75 points of credit towards the BProp (if you have passed courses with a B grade average)
  • Be considered for entry but will not be eligible for credit (if you have passed courses with less than a B grade average). List of MIT diplomas.

 

Entry with a partially completed MIT diploma

If you have a partially completed MIT diploma (Level 6 or 7) and a B grade average for passed courses, you will be considered for entry to the BProp. List of MIT diplomas.

 

Transfer with a partially completed MIT degree qualification

To transfer from MIT and complete the BProp at the University you must:

  • Have passed courses at MIT that can be credited towards the BProp. See Course equivalencies.
  • Have passed MIT courses with an average grade of B+ or higher.


Completing the University BProp

The BProp consists of 360 points, including 330 points from Parts I, II and III and 30 points from approved General Education courses. If you are a full-time student, the degree can be completed in three years. Part-time study options are also available.

The chart below will help you determine which MIT courses you can credit towards the University degree. Once you have established the courses, you are encouraged to discuss your programme plan with a student adviser.

BProp courses - course equivalencies

 MIT course    Equivalent University of Auckland course   Points value  
311.527 Business Accounting   ACCTG 101 Accounting Information   15  
323.508 Commercial Law 1   Stage I course in Commercial Law (unspecified credit)   15  
143.504 Statistics for Decision Making   STATS 108 Statistics for Commerce   15  
371.512 Business Economics   ECON 191 Business Economics   15
